Unlike earlier speech synthesis models that required separate training for each voice or language, Voicebox uses a flow-matching architecture to learn from diverse speech data. This allows it to edit existing audio clips\u2014such as replacing a mispronounced word, changing the tone or emotion, or even translating speech while preserving the original speaker&#8217;s voice.
